The invention relates to determining rolling distance of a vehicle and, more particularly, to structure and a strategy for determining rolling distance from standstill so that an Electronic Brake System (EBS) of the vehicle can start building-up pressure once the vehicle begins rolling.
In a vehicle EBS with Automatic Vehicle Hold (AVH) or with Full Speed Range Adaptive (FSRA) cruise control, normally the rolling distance from standstill needs to be determined. When vehicle starts rolling, the EBS needs to build pressure (by running a hydraulic pump or active booster, etc.) to bring vehicle back to standstill. However, current vehicle rolling detection is too sensitive and it leads to multiple pump or active booster activations that generate noticeable noise.
There is a need for improved rolling distance detection structure that does not require running the pump too frequently and thereby reduces Noise, Vibration and Harshness (NVH) in a vehicle.
An objective of the invention is to fulfill the need referred to above. In accordance with the principles of an embodiment, this objective is obtained by providing a system for detecting and controlling rolling distance of a vehicle from standstill. The system includes a tone wheel mounted to an associated wheel of a vehicle so as to rotate there-with. Each tone wheel has a plurality of encoding members spaced substantially evenly about a periphery thereof. A speed sensor is associated with each tone wheel so as to generate a signal when an encoding member passes the sensor. A control unit in an EBS is constructed and arranged to receive the signals from the sensors. The control unit has a microprocessor circuit. When the vehicle rolls from standstill with the wheels rotating the associated tone wheels, the sensors are constructed and arranged to send the signals to the control unit with microprocessor circuit counting as an interrupt, when one of the encoding members passes an associated sensor. When a maximum allowed number of interrupts is counted at each wheel, the control unit within the EBS is constructed and arranged to command the brake system to be supplied with pressure increase to return the vehicle to, and hold the vehicle at, standstill prior to reaching the required rolling distance.
In accordance with another aspect of an embodiment, a method detects and controls the rolling distance of a vehicle from standstill. The vehicle includes a tone wheel having a plurality of encoding members spaced substantially evenly about a periphery thereof. Each tone wheel is constructed and arranged to rotate with an associated wheel. A fixed speed sensor is mounted generally adjacent to each tone wheel. The vehicle includes a brake system. The method determines a travel distance between adjacent encoding members based on the number of encoding members and the tire circumference of the wheel. A required rolling distance of a vehicle from standstill is established. Maximum allowed interrupts per wheel is established, with an interrupt being defined as each instance an encoding member passes an associated speed sensor. It is determined whether the vehicle is actually rolling from standstill. Once the vehicle is actually rolling, a number of interrupts is counted at each wheel. Upon the occurrence of the maximum allowed interrupts counted at each wheel, the brake system is supplied with pressure increase to return the vehicle to, and hold the vehicle at, standstill prior to reaching the required rolling distance.
Other objects, features and characteristics of the present invention, as well as the methods of operation and the functions of the related elements of the structure, the combination of parts and economics of manufacture will become more apparent upon consideration of the following detailed description and appended claims with reference to the accompanying drawings, all of which form a part of this specification.
The invention will be better understood from the following detailed description of the preferred embodiments thereof, taken in conjunction with the accompanying drawings, wherein like reference numerals refer to like parts, in which:
With reference to
The sensor 12 is constructed and arranged to measure the speed and direction A of rotation of the tone wheel 14 to thus determine the road wheel speed of the vehicle. In the embodiment, the sensor 12 detects when the encoding members (teeth) 16 pass by the sensor 12. The sensor 12 is electrically connected with an electronic control unit (ECU) 18 of an Electronic Brake System (EBS) 20. The control unit 18 has microprocessor circuit 19 to execute the logic described below. The EBS 20 can support Automatic Vehicle Hold (AVH) function 22 and Full Speed Range Adaptive (FSRA) cruise control function 23 for the vehicle.
The sensor 12 may monitor the rotation of the crankshaft or driveshaft of a vehicle, when the rate at which individual wheels are turning does not need to be determined. In the embodiment, the sensor 12 monitors the rotation of the casing or axle 24 (
The sensor 12 is preferably of the conventional magnetic type when the tone wheel 14 is made of steel. The sensor 12 can be a variable reluctance type sensor or a Hall effect sensor. Both of these magnetic type sensors detect the teeth 16 of the steel tone wheel 14 as it rotates adjacent to the sensor 12. Variable reluctance sensors detect the change in the inductance of a wire coil as a steel tooth comes into close proximity. Hall effect sensors measure the change in the resistance of a semi-conducting slab due to the strength of an applied magnetic field. The Hall effect sensor 12 acts much like a magnetic switch. When a tooth 16 of the tone wheel 14 rotates past the sensor 12, current is allowed to flow creating an output signal 32 from the sensor 12, with the number of times the teeth pass the sensor 12 being counted by the control unit 18. Instead of using a magnetic sensor 12, and steel tone wheel 14 with teeth 16, the sensor 12 can be of the conventional, optical type, with the wheel tone being optically encoded (defining the encoding members 16).
In a vehicle EBS with Automatic Vehicle Hold (AVH) or Full Speed Range Adaptive (FSRA) cruise control, the rolling distance from standstill needs to be determined. When vehicle starts rolling, the EBS needs to build pressure by running a hydraulic pump to bring vehicle back to standstill. Thus, in accordance with an embodiment, a travel distance per tooth is first calculated. For example, if the tone wheel 14 has fifty teeth 16 and the circumference of the tire is two meters or 2,000 mm, then the distance a tire/wheel will travel between adjacent teeth 16 is 2000/50=40 mm. Thus, the travel distance per tooth for the example system 10 is 40 mm.
For a given customer requirement on the rolling distance during AVH/FSRA, using the sensor structure 10, the rolling distance can be converted into wheel interrupts permitted on each wheel, based on the travel distance between each tooth 16.
An example of a customer requirement on rolling distance is: the maximum distance the vehicle is allowed to roll is less than 160 mm on a 10% grade. This requirement can be interpreted as maximum allowed teeth rolled=160 mm/travel distance per tooth=160/40=4 (teeth). Thus, an interrupt 34 occurs once a tooth 16 passes by the sensor 12, so if more than four interrupts are detected on one wheel when the vehicle is rolling, the rolling distance will exceed 160 mm. To make sure that there is enough time to build pressure to bring the vehicle back to standstill, the maximum allowed interrupts 34 (four in the example) is reduced to about 1.5 to 2 interrupts 34 per wheel.
With reference to
Since all four wheels are being monitored, a situation is to be avoided wherein the vehicle is oscillating back and forth (considered as not rolling), which might cause one specific tooth 16 to pass back and forth by the sensor 12. With four wheels, the possibility of one specific tooth on each wheel oscillating back and forth around the sensor 12 is very low, which reduces the risk of false rolling detection. Thus, in accordance with an embodiment, to determine whether the vehicle is actually rolling, the system 10 monitors six interrupts 34 (1.5 interrupts per wheel×4 wheels) on all four wheels over a predefined time. This is termed the maximum allowed total interrupts.
As noted above, the vehicle rolling detection strategy can be used by Automatic Vehicle Hold (AVH) function or Full Speed-range ACC (FSA or ACC Stop and Go) function, or any function which has a rolling distance requirement. The signal 42 of
With reference to
Thus, the vehicle rolling detection strategy of the embodiment can be customized based on the customer rolling distance requirement. This vehicle rolling detection strategy avoids unnecessary pressure build (pump activation or active booster activation) if vehicle just slightly moves and it's within customer defined range. Therefore, Noise, Vibration and Harshness (NVH) in a vehicle can be avoided.
The operations described herein can be implemented as executable code within the EBS 20 microprocessor circuit 19 as described or stored on a standalone computer or machine readable non-transitory tangible storage medium (e.g., floppy disk, hard disk, ROM, EEPROM, nonvolatile RAM, CD-ROM, etc.) that are completed based on execution of the code by a processor circuit implemented using one or more integrated circuits; the operations described herein also can be implemented as executable logic that is encoded in one or more non-transitory tangible media for execution (e.g., programmable logic arrays or devices, field programmable gate arrays, programmable array logic, application specific integrated circuits, etc.).
The foregoing preferred embodiments have been shown and described for the purposes of illustrating the structural and functional principles of the present invention, as well as illustrating the methods of employing the preferred embodiments and are subject to change without departing from such principles. Therefore, this invention includes all modifications encompassed within the spirit of the following claims.